      Using MariaDB for a few months without any problem, last Thursday all tables except one disappeared from one of the databases.
      I didn't have binary log active. (sad, I know)
      Trying to repair the tables didn’t work with error that the tables don’t exist.
      Trying to innodb_force_recover until 6 (all tables are in innodb format), the system recovered two other tables, but without data.

      From the logs I’m almost sure there was no hacking attack and I’m sure I don’t have any drop command from any application, and I also check HeidiSQL logs for any command like a drop or something that could do this and I didn’t found nothing.
      I recovered most of the data from last backup and some data from my application logs, and in the next morning the plant could restart the production. (one problem during restore is the disable keys command doesn’t work on innodb tables and so some data was not restored)

      Now I need your tips/help for the following:

      • I need to explain to the client and to my boss what occurred. (using mySQL for 2 decades never had nothing like this). There is any issue that can affect this version? What log files should I check?
      • I need to take some measures to ensure that it will not happen again in the future. Any advice?
